Output e93aac40388ab4dd1ae878316dd91d0df7dd68322382382685d80aee80010f87:5

value
10661
script pubkey
OP_0 OP_PUSHBYTES_20 690a384395a5d1890c023a62cf8dbee0582b3a51
address
bc1qdy9rssu45hgcjrqz8f3vlrd7upvzkwj36ky87f
transaction
e93aac40388ab4dd1ae878316dd91d0df7dd68322382382685d80aee80010f87